1.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

Overview: SEO is the practice of optimizing your website and content to rank higher in search engine results pages (SERPs). The goal is to increase organic traffic by improving the visibility of your website for relevant search queries.

Key Elements:

  • Keyword Research: Identifying and using relevant keywords that your target audience is searching for.
  • On-Page SEO: Optimizing individual pages with proper tags, headings, and content structure.
  • Off-Page SEO: Building backlinks and improving your site’s authority through external sources.
  • Technical SEO: Ensuring your website’s technical aspects, like loading speed and mobile compatibility, are optimized.

Benefits: Higher visibility in search engines leads to more organic traffic, better user experience, and increased credibility.

2. Content Marketing

Overview: Content marketing involves creating and sharing valuable content to attract and engage your target audience. The aim is to provide useful information that solves problems or meets the needs of your audience.

Key Elements:

  • Blog Posts: Writing articles that provide valuable insights or solutions.
  • Infographics: Visual content that simplifies complex information.
  • Videos: Engaging and informative videos that capture audience attention.
  • eBooks and White Papers: In-depth resources that offer comprehensive information on specific topics.

Benefits: Builds trust with your audience, establishes authority in your industry, and drives traffic and leads.

3. Social Media Marketing

Overview: Social media marketing involves using social media platforms to promote your brand, engage with your audience, and drive traffic. This includes plat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, and more.

Key Elements:

  • Content Creation: Developing posts, images, and videos tailored to each platform.
  • Community Management: Engaging with followers, responding to comments, and managing conversations.
  • Advertising: Running paid campaigns to reach a broader audience and achieve specific goals.

Benefits: Increases brand awareness, fosters customer engagement, and drives traffic and conversions.

4. Email Marketing

Overview: Email marketing is the use of email to communicate with your audience, build relationships, and promote products or services. It’s a direct way to reach your subscribers and nurture leads.

Key Elements:

  • Newsletters: Regular updates with company news, offers, or industry insights.
  • Automated Campaigns: Triggered emails based on user behavior, such as cart abandonment or welcome sequences.
  • Segmentation: Targeting specific groups within your email list based on their interests or behavior.

Benefits: Personalizes communication, nurtures leads, and drives conversions through targeted messaging.

5. Pay-Per-Click Advertising (PPC)

Overview: PPC is a form of online advertising where you pay each time someone clicks on your ad. This includes search engine ads (like Google Ads) and social media ads.

Key Elements:

  • Keyword Bidding: Selecting and bidding on keywords relevant to your business.
  • Ad Creation: Designing compelling ads that encourage users to click.
  • Campaign Management: Monitoring and optimizing ad performance to maximize ROI.

Benefits: Provides immediate visibility, targets specific audiences, and allows for precise tracking and optimization.

6. Affiliate Marketing

Overview: Affiliate marketing involves partnering with other businesses or individuals (affiliates) who promote your products or services in exchange for a commission on sales or leads they generate.

Key Elements:

  • Affiliate Partnerships: Recruiting and managing affiliates who promote your brand.
  • Tracking and Reporting: Monitoring affiliate performance and compensating them based on results.
  • Promotional Materials: Providing affiliates with content and resources to aid their promotion efforts.

Benefits: Expands your reach, leverages the networks of affiliates, and only pays for results.

7. Influencer Marketing

Overview: Influencer marketing involves collaborating with influencers—individuals with a large and engaged following on social media or other platforms—to promote your brand or products.

Key Elements:

  • Influencer Identification: Finding influencers whose audience aligns with your target market.
  • Campaign Collaboration: Working with influencers to create authentic content that promotes your brand.
  • Performance Measurement: Tracking the impact of influencer partnerships on brand awareness and sales.

Benefits: Enhances credibility, reaches targeted audiences, and drives engagement through trusted voices.

8. Online Public Relations (PR)

Overview: Online PR focuses on managing and improving your brand’s online reputation through digital channels. This includes securing online coverage, managing reviews, and engaging with media.

Key Elements:

  • Media Outreach: Building relationships with online journalists and bloggers to secure coverage.
  • Reputation Management: Monitoring and addressing online reviews and mentions.
  • Press Releases: Distributing news and updates to online media outlets.

Benefits: Enhances brand reputation, builds credibility, and improves visibility through earned media.
